课程核心价值
针对CG行业从业者与应届毕业生设计的UE4开发课程,重点培养虚幻引擎4的实战应用能力。通过案例式教学掌握蓝图系统搭建、C++编程调试、3D场景构建等关键技术节点,完成从引擎基础到网络通信开发的完整知识体系构建。
适配学员类型分析
| 学员类型 | 技术提升方向 | 职业发展路径 |
|---|---|---|
| 在职CG设计师 | 实时渲染技术迭代 | 技术美术专家方向 |
| 游戏开发爱好者 | 完整开发流程掌握 | 独立游戏开发者 |
| 应届毕业生 | 企业级项目经验积累 | 游戏程序员岗位 |
教学体系解析
阶段:引擎核心模块
- 3D资产处理规范与优化流程
- 蓝图系统可视化编程实践
- PBR材质系统与灯光架构
第二阶段:编程深度实践
从内存管理基础到虚幻专用数据类型,系统讲解C++在游戏开发中的特殊应用场景。重点解析UObject内存机制、智能指针应用、反射系统实现原理等核心知识点。
第三阶段:网络通信开发
基于TCP/IP协议栈实现多人在线功能,结合Protobuf数据序列化框架进行网络通信优化。通过《FlappyBird》完整案例掌握移动端打包发布全流程。
保障体系
- • 与完美世界、网易等企业建立人才输送通道
- • 毕业作品直接参与企业项目评审
- • 6个月技术跟踪指导服务
教学特色说明
实时项目驱动
课程中穿插《横板过关》《多人对战》等商业级项目案例,每阶段设置项目答辩环节,模拟真实开发环境。
代码审查机制
采用GitLab进行版本控制,每周进行代码质量评审,培养符合企业规范的编程习惯。
